Instant Pot Cheesy Asparagus Wrapped In Bacon

Welcome to my latest Instant Pot recipe and this recipe is for Instant Pot cheesy asparagus wrapped in bacon.
Prep Time2 minutes
Cook Time3 minutes
Total Time5 minutes
Course: Side Dish, Snack
Cuisine: Instant Pot
Servings: 2
Calories: 199kcal

Ingredients

Instructions

  • Place 160ml of water into the bottom of your Instant Pot and you can measure it out with the cup provided.
  • Chop the bottom end off the asparagus. Smoother it with soft cheese and then wrap it in bacon. When done place them all on the steamer rack.
  • Place the lid on your Instant Pot and set the valve to sealing and press steam for 3 minutes.
  • Once it has started it will beep and it will beep 6 times when done. Once it has cooled down from keep warm mode you can get it out.
  • Serve.

Notes

I prefer this recipe with soft cheese but as an alternative you could make it with butter instead. Or for the perfect Paleo snack use coconut oil instead. So many choices.
